Overview: marketing

AI blog writing about marketing is most effective when it follows a structured, repeatable workflow designed for both readers and search engines. Start by defining the audience and search intent—what questions are they asking, and what outcome do they want? Convert that research into a SERP‑informed outline that balances clarity with depth: definitions, step‑by‑step guidance, examples, and FAQs. Drafts should use concise language, consistent headings, and embedded calls‑to‑action that connect content to your business goals. By standardizing this structure, you can scale production without sacrificing quality, ensuring each article about marketing is useful, discoverable, and trustworthy.

Quality control is where AI content succeeds or fails. Establish editorial guardrails for marketing: tone of voice, factual verification, and non‑negotiable style rules (like using short paragraphs, descriptive subheads, and plain‑English explanations). Integrate an approval checklist that reviews accuracy, completeness, and alignment with search intent. Then, add the technical pieces that move the needle: internal links to related marketing pages, schema markup for FAQs or HowTo sections, and optimized metadata. This combination of editorial rigor and technical SEO makes AI‑assisted articles perform consistently across large libraries.

To keep AI blog writing about marketing human and credible, incorporate expert commentary and real examples. Invite SMEs to contribute short quotes or decision checklists that reflect how work actually gets done. Use visuals, code snippets, or tables when they clarify trade‑offs. Close with a recap that reinforces outcomes and suggests a concrete next step. Over time, measure performance (rankings, CTR, scroll depth), then update templates and briefs accordingly. This cycle turns AI into a force multiplier for your team, not a source of generic text.

Distribution is part of the workflow, not an afterthought. Slice each marketing article into derivative assets—email summaries, social threads, and internal enablement notes—so the core ideas reach multiple channels. Because the content is structurally consistent, reformatting is fast and predictable. Meanwhile, your internal link network grows with each publish, helping new pages get discovered and older pages retain visibility. The result is a resilient content system where individual articles reinforce the performance of the whole.

Finally, treat your marketing content as a product. Maintain version history, run periodic refreshes, and expand sections that show strong engagement signals. Use reader feedback to prioritize new angles and clarify ambiguous steps. When AI writing operates inside a disciplined process, you can publish at high velocity without losing the craftsmanship that keeps readers coming back.
